The revised Code has been approved by the Joint Insolvency Committee and the Insolvency Practioners Association (IPA), and ICAEW and ICAS as the recognised professional bodies (RPBs).
The main revisions relate to:
• professional behaviour;
• role and mindset; and
• technology.
The revised Code clarifies how IPs should behave as professionals, and the context in which they would be considered to be acting in their professional lives, as opposed to their private lives.
The test for assessing the seriousness of any poor conduct is that which a ‘reasonable and informed third party’ would conclude brings discredit to the profession.
A new paragraph has been introduced to clarify those expectations. The concept of a ‘reasonable and informed third party’ already features elsewhere in the Code but to clarify the expectations of an IP’s personal conduct, the revised paragraph 2105.1 A2 now reads:
